Abstract

The utility model discloses a novel sputum suction tube, which comprises a sputum suction tube main body; the sputum suction pipe main body comprises a three-way pipe (1) and a sputum suction hose (2); the sputum suction hose (2) is connected to one side of the three-way pipe (1); a rotatable valve core (3) is arranged in the three-way pipe (1); the upper end of the rotatable valve core (3) is provided with a valve (4); a through hole (7) is arranged in the rotatable valve core (3); the through hole (7) is connected with pipelines at two sides of the three-way pipe (1); according to the utility model, the three-way pipe is arranged on the sputum suction pipe, the rotatable valve core is arranged in the three-way pipe, the valve core is arranged at the upper end of the valve core, and the rotary valve controls the opening and closing of the rotatable valve core, so that the operation of medical personnel is facilitated.

Novel sputum suction tube
Technical Field
The utility model relates to the technical field of medical equipment, in particular to a novel sputum suction tube.
Background
A sputum suction tube which is commonly used clinically is provided with a closed opening, but a sealing cap is arranged on the sealing opening at ordinary times, the sealing cap is generally arranged on the sealing opening in a rotating mode, the sputum suction tube is inconvenient to use when operated by a single hand, and the sealing opening is open at ordinary times and communicated with the outside.
Disclosure of Invention
The utility model aims to solve the technical problem of providing a novel sputum suction tube, wherein a three-way tube is arranged on the sputum suction tube, a rotatable valve core is arranged in the three-way tube, a valve flap is arranged at the upper end of the valve core, and the rotatable valve core is controlled to be opened and closed by the rotatable valve flap, so that the novel sputum suction tube is convenient for the operation of medical personnel.
The novel sputum suction tube is realized by the following technical scheme: comprises a sputum aspirator main body; the sputum suction pipe main body comprises a three-way pipe and a sputum suction hose; the sputum suction hose is connected to one side of the three-way pipe;
a rotatable valve core is arranged in the three-way pipe; the upper end of the rotatable valve core is provided with a valve;
a through hole is arranged in the rotatable valve core; the through hole is connected with the pipelines at the two sides of the three-way pipe.
As the preferred technical scheme, one side of the three-way pipe is provided with a sputum suction pipe conical head.
As the preferred technical scheme, a sputum suction pipe connecting piece is arranged between the sputum suction hose and the three-way pipe.
As the preferred technical scheme, the three-way pipe, the sputum suction hose and the rotatable valve core are made of PPC materials.
As the preferred technical scheme, a damping ring is arranged between the rotatable valve core and the three-way pipe.
The utility model has the beneficial effects that: through installing the three-way pipe on inhaling the phlegm pipe, set up rotatable case in the three-way pipe, at case upper end installation flap, the opening and closing of rotatable case of rotatory flap control, the medical personnel's of being convenient for operation, simultaneously, inhale the phlegm pipe main part and be the seal, prevent that medical personnel operation process from being contaminated.

As shown in figures 1 and 2, the novel sputum aspirator of the utility model comprises a sputum aspirator main body; the sputum suction pipe main body comprises a three-way pipe 1 and a sputum suction hose 2; the sputum suction hose 2 is connected to one side of the three-way pipe 1;
a rotatable valve core 3 is arranged in the three-way pipe 1; the upper end of the rotatable valve core 3 is provided with a valve 4;
a through hole 7 is arranged in the rotatable valve core 3; the through hole 7 is connected with the pipelines at two sides of the three-way pipe 1.
In this embodiment, a sputum suction pipe conical head 5 is installed on one side of the three-way pipe 1, and the sputum suction pipe conical head 5 is connected with a negative pressure pipe to generate negative pressure.
In this embodiment, a sputum suction tube connector 8 is installed between the sputum suction hose 2 and the three-way tube 1.
In this embodiment, the upper surface of the flap 4 is provided with an indicating arrow for opening and closing, which is convenient for the medical staff to work.
In the embodiment, the three-way pipe 1, the sputum suction hose 2 and the rotatable valve core 3 are made of PPC materials, and the PPC materials have the characteristics of high chemical stability, good plasticity, complete degradation and the like.
In this embodiment, a damping ring 6 is installed between the rotatable valve core 3 and the three-way pipe 1, so that the resistance between the rotatable valve core 3 and the three-way pipe 1 is increased, and the rotatable valve core 3 is prevented from rotating in the three-way pipe 1.
In the embodiment, when the direction of the valve 4 is consistent with that of the sputum suction hose 2, the rotatable valve core 3 is communicated with the pipelines at two sides of the three-way pipe 1; when the direction of the valve 4 is vertical to that of the sputum suction hose 2, the connection between the rotatable valve core 3 and the pipelines at the two sides of the three-way pipe 1 is closed; of course, the on and off of the rotary valve core 3 and the three-way pipe 1 can be represented in other directions.
The working process is as follows: when the direction of the valve is consistent with that of the sputum suction hose, the rotatable valve core is connected and communicated with the pipelines at the two sides of the three-way pipe 1, and the negative pressure can penetrate through the whole pipe and is communicated; when the valve flap is perpendicular to the direction of the sputum suction hose, the connection between the rotatable valve core and the pipelines at two sides of the three-way pipe is closed, and if the valve flap is closed, the negative pressure is too low.
